Question:

An atom of an element contains 29 electrons and 35 neutrons.
Deduce (i) the number of protons and (ii) the electronic configuration of the element.

Answer:

An atom consists of protons, electrons & neutrons.A positive atom will contain higher number of proton(H+), a negative atom will have higher number of electrons(e-) & a neutral atom will contain same number of protons & electrons.Therefore,

(i) For an atom to be neutral, the number of protons is equal to the number of electrons.

∴ Number of protons in the atom of the given element = 29

(ii) The electronic configuration of the atom is

1s2 2s2 2p6 3s2 3p6 4s1 3d10. Which is the electronic configuration of copper
